Gaillardia lanceolata
What's the taxonomical classification of Gaillardia lanceolata?
Gaillardia lanceolata belongs to the kingdom Plantae and is classified within the phylum Streptophyta. As a member of the class Equisetopsida and the subclass Magnoliidae, it follows the taxonomic lineage of the order Asterales. It is a prominent representative of the family Asteraceae, a group known for its complex flower heads. Within this family, the plant is categorized under the genus Gaillardia, and its specific identification is completed by the species name lanceolata.

What are the morphological characteristics of this plant?
Gaillardia lanceolata has lanceolate to narrowly ovate leaves that are typically 1 to 4 inches long and possess serrated margins. The plant features a perennial root system that often forms woody bases or rhizomes. Its inflorescences consist of composite flower heads characterized by ray florets with bright red or orange centers and yellowish outer tips. The central disk florets are tubular and clustered together to form a prominent golden core. Stems are generally erect and can reach heights of approximately 12 to 24 inches depending on the environment.
What is the geographical distribution of this plant?
This plant is native to the southeastern United States, specifically spanning from eastern Texas through the Gulf Coast states and up into North Carolina. It thrives in various environments ranging from open woodlands and thickets to roadside ditches and forest edges. Within its natural range, the species prefers well-drained soils and areas with full sun exposure. While primarily found in the southern United States, it can occasionally be found in parts of Mexico. Its ability to colonize disturbed areas allows it to spread effectively across its traditional ecological niche.
How is this plant cultivated?
This plant requires full sun and well-draining soil to thrive in temperate garden environments.
You should plant it in sandy or loamy textures to prevent root rot caused by excess moisture. While it is relatively drought-tolerant once established, regular watering during extreme heat helps maintain its vibrant floral display. Pruning the stems back in early spring encourages vigorous new growth and more prolific blooming.
This perennial is also quite hardy and can withstand various soil types as long as drainage remains efficient.
